Learning objectives of the MPhil in Informatics, are the understanding of technology, its application, the development of critical thinking and scientific and technical communication. This course offers two specializations, Information Systems (I.S.) and Software Engineering (S.E.), where it is assumed that both develop a common knowledge base, particularly in modeling techniques, emerging technologies, project management and technological innovation; considering that these areas of expertise are the key to the two areas. However, specializations give different skills within the information technology field; S.I. students will be able to enhance the business through the use of technology and drive and lead S.I. of intervention activities using best practices; turn the E.S. students will be able to plan, manage and conduct development activities of highly complex software systems and to use emerging technology.


Why choose this programme

The MPhil in Informatics allows acquiring knowledge, specialized and necessary for better professional performance and development in the current Knowledge Society. The course provides specialized education in emerging areas: Information Systems and Software Engineering. This course has a mostly doctoral teaching staff at leading universities, which introduces a dynamic and plurality of views that enrich the education. During the two years, on the one hand, the course includes a series of seminars in emerging areas targeted by professionals prestigious, and teachers from foreign universities and, on the other hand, also allows students from the 1st courses cycle acquire more skills at the behavioral level, now so demand by the employers. As is typical in the Department of Economics, Management and Informatics (DEGI)courses, is provided a proximity education, which ensures the quality of training, and consequently the success of the MPhil placement in the labor market.

Career prospects

IT Consultant, Project Manager, Network Manager, Senior Programmer mobile solutions and multimedia


For specialization in Software Engineering students should have a set of skills:

  • To plan, manage and conduct development activities of highly complex software systems;
  • To know how to define technological solutions to solve complex organizational problems;
  • To diagnose problems associated with the use of computer technologies and systems;
  • To Know how to plan and manage the technology services support infrastructure in organizations;
  • To ensure information security and supporting infrastructure;
  • To understand, manage and control the risks associated with IT;
  • To acquire critical thinking and reflective attitude;
  • Become familiar with the R & D process in order to monitor the evolution of the area body of knowledge and to participate in them;
  • To acquire leadership posture, sense of ethics and professional responsibility.

Admission requirements

  • Bachelor level degree in Management, Economics or any related area
  • Minimum English Proficiency level according to the Common European Framework of Reference for Languages: B2 – Independent - Vantage or upper intermediate Evaluation of the CV
  • An interview (live or Skype)

Objectives and Course structure

The MPhil is a post-graduate program aimed at preparing the student to take leadership roles in the knowledge and application of technologies, as well as critical thinking development and scientific and technical communication skills.

The course allows a common basis for structuring knowledge, namely concerning modeling techniques, emerging technologies, project management and technological innovation.

The course’s specific objectives are to know how to plan, control, and perform development activities of highly complex software systems using emergent technologies, and to delineate technological solutions to address organizations’ problems of high complexity. The planning and management of the infrastructure supporting the organizational technological services consist in another core field of expertise, as well as to ensure high-security standards and risk management. The professional ethics and leadership role are developed within critical thinking and responsible attitudes.

The course follows the best international practices and is aligned with the ACM/IEEE curriculum recommendations. Moreover, it is accredited by the national authority agency A3ES, and the UPT is the unique Portuguese private university to hold a global certificate quality.

The two-year course program comprises twelve mandatory curricular units providing a mix of theoretical underpinning, technical skills and perspectives on software engineering. It then culminates with an applied research and development experience that can be an internship, project or a thesis.

Program taught in:

See 2 more programs offered by Oporto Global University - Universidade Portucalense »

Last updated June 19, 2019
This course is Campus based
Start Date
Open Enrollment
2 - 2 years
5,100 EUR
By locations
By date
Start Date
Open Enrollment
End Date
Application deadline

Open Enrollment

Application deadline
End Date

Universidade Portucalense

UPT: Feira de Emprego “Careers UPT 2019”